Tag: skikshaniketan

Rural Education
Envisioning a Truly Independent India on Independence Day
Independence Day is a time to acknowledge the past while looking towards a future where everyone can live favourably. This year, Barefoot’s Shikshaniketan school embraced a critical and constructive approach to celebrating the 73rd Independence...



Verified by MonsterInsights